New Delhi: Delhi Police on Monday registered an FIR against the Station House Officer (SHO) of Delhi Cantt for molesting a woman journalist and sent him to district line, a senior officer said.

The complainant's statement was recorded in front of Additional DCP Monika Bharadwaj, who is also heading the investigation in the matter, said the officer.

The SHO was been sent to district lines and a case under section 354 A (sexual harassment) of Indian Penal Code has been registered against him, while the matter has been transferred to the Crime Branch.

Earlier in the day scores of journalist gathered at Press Club of India to stage a protest against the recent assault on journalists and molestation of a female journalist while they were covering a peaceful march organised by Jawaharlal Nehru University Student Union and its teachers association on Friday.

At JNU's student protest, a group of women police officers were found beating up a photo-journalist on March 24 in a video circulating on social media networking sites.

Indore (PTI): The classmate of a 24-year-old female MBA student, arrested in Indore for her murder, allegedly abused the body after the killing and also performed occult rituals while on the run, police said.

On February 13, people complained of a foul smell emanating from a closed house in the city's Dwarkapuri police station area.

After police arrived at the scene, the naked body of a 24-year-old woman was found in the house.

The woman was pursuing a Master of Business Administration (MBA) degree from a city college and the body was found in her classmate's rented house, Deputy Commissioner of Police (DCP) Shrikrishna Lalchandani told PTI on Monday.

The classmate fled after the incident. He was taken into custody in Mumbai and is being interrogated after his arrest, the official said.

Referring to the accused's interrogation, the official said he allegedly strangled his classmate to death and then "abused" the body.

"The accused also performed witchcraft near Panvel (in Navi Mumbai) while on the run. The accused claims that he was mentally disturbed after the murder and wanted to communicate with the woman's spirit through witchcraft," he said.

According to the DCP, the woman and the accused were in a close relationship.

"The accused suspected that she was talking to other men. Enraged, he killed her and fled," the official said.

After the woman's body was found, her father accused the classmate of trying to extort money from his daughter using her obscene photos and then torturing her to death.

The accused had even posted these photos on her college WhatsApp group, he alleged.
